Pedro Glusman Knijnik is a urological surgeon and researcher whose work centers on refining robotic-assisted radical prostatectomy (RARP) to improve patient outcomes. His primary research areas include nerve-sparing surgical techniques, early catheter removal protocols, and comprehensive outcome metrics for prostate cancer surgery. Knijnik’s major contributions involve developing and validating composite outcome measures—such as the "trifecta" and "pentafecta"—that simultaneously assess cancer control, urinary continence, and erectile function. His 2022 study on nerve-sparing grading in robotic prostatectomy (4 citations) established a standardized approach to preserving neurovascular bundles, directly correlating surgical technique with improved functional recovery. Knijnik also pioneered early Foley catheter removal on postoperative day one (2021), demonstrating reduced patient discomfort without compromising safety. His 2023 pentafecta analysis (2 citations) provided a holistic framework for evaluating surgical success during a hospital’s initial RARP experience, integrating biochemical recurrence, complications, and quality of life.
